118.435 Time of election of presidential electors. The election of electors of President and Vice President of the United States shall be held <br>on the Tuesday next after the first Monday in November every four (4) years, beginning <br>with 1892. The Governor may, by proclamation, appoint the same day in any other year, <br>pursuant to Act of Congress, for holding the election, in the event of a vacancy in the <br>offices of President and Vice President. Effective: June 21, 1974 <br>History: Amended 1974 Ky. Acts ch. 130, sec. 129, effective June 21, 1974.
